Compare all timetables for the bus from Viana do Castelo to Braga
| Mode of Transport | BertCompanyCountOneCompanyName | Duration | Departure time | From | Departure | Arrival time | To | Destination | Logo | Seat classes | Price | |
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Rede Expressos | 0h 45m | 7:45 AM | Viana do Castelo | Bus Station | 8:30 AM | Braga | Central Bus Station | Economy | $7 |
A Bus from Rede Expressos goes from Bus Station, Viana do Castelo (Portugal) at 12/17/2025 7:45:00 AM to Central Bus Station, Braga (Portugal) arriving at 12/17/2025 8:30:00 AM. 50 Economy ticket for $7 per person are available. Travel duration is 0h 45m
|
||
| Rede Expressos | 0h 45m | 4:15 PM | Viana do Castelo | Bus Station | 5:00 PM | Braga | Central Bus Station | Economy | $7 |
A Bus from Rede Expressos goes from Bus Station, Viana do Castelo (Portugal) at 12/17/2025 4:15:00 PM to Central Bus Station, Braga (Portugal) arriving at 12/17/2025 5:00:00 PM. 50 Economy ticket for $7 per person are available. Travel duration is 0h 45m
|
| Mode of Transport | BertCompanyCountOneCompanyName | Duration | Departure time | From | Departure | Arrival time | To | Destination | Logo | Seat classes | Price | |
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Rede Expressos | 0h 45m | 7:45 AM | Viana do Castelo | Bus Station | 8:30 AM | Braga | Central Bus Station | Economy | $7 |
A Bus from Rede Expressos goes from Bus Station, Viana do Castelo (Portugal) at 12/18/2025 7:45:00 AM to Central Bus Station, Braga (Portugal) arriving at 12/18/2025 8:30:00 AM. 50 Economy ticket for $7 per person are available. Travel duration is 0h 45m
|
||
| Rede Expressos | 0h 45m | 4:15 PM | Viana do Castelo | Bus Station | 5:00 PM | Braga | Central Bus Station | Basic | $8 |
A Bus from Rede Expressos goes from Bus Station, Viana do Castelo (Portugal) at 12/18/2025 4:15:00 PM to Central Bus Station, Braga (Portugal) arriving at 12/18/2025 5:00:00 PM. 50 Basic ticket for $8 per person are available. Travel duration is 0h 45m
|
| Mode of Transport | BertCompanyCountOneCompanyName | Duration | Departure time | From | Departure | Arrival time | To | Destination | Logo | Seat classes | Price | |
|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Rede Expressos | 0h 45m | 7:45 AM | Viana do Castelo | Bus Station | 8:30 AM | Braga | Central Bus Station | Economy | $7 |
A Bus from Rede Expressos goes from Bus Station, Viana do Castelo (Portugal) at 12/21/2025 7:45:00 AM to Central Bus Station, Braga (Portugal) arriving at 12/21/2025 8:30:00 AM. 50 Economy ticket for $7 per person are available. Travel duration is 0h 45m
|
||
| Rede Expressos | 0h 45m | 4:15 PM | Viana do Castelo | Bus Station | 5:00 PM | Braga | Central Bus Station | Basic | $8 |
A Bus from Rede Expressos goes from Bus Station, Viana do Castelo (Portugal) at 12/21/2025 4:15:00 PM to Central Bus Station, Braga (Portugal) arriving at 12/21/2025 5:00:00 PM. 50 Basic ticket for $8 per person are available. Travel duration is 0h 45m
|
Best Price Offer: The price for the cheapest bus from Viana do Castelo to Braga is $7 on 12/17/2025. Flexible travelers save on ticket prices.
Frequency of bus connections between Viana do Castelo and Braga
Facts about the bus from Viana do Castelo to Braga
Compare all providers like Rede Expressos that travel 3 times every day by bus from Viana do Castelo to Braga in one click! Book your bus ticket from Viana do Castelo to Braga starting from $7!
| Cheapest Bus | $7 |
| Fastest Bus | 0h 45m |
| Earliest Bus | 7:45 AM |
| Latest Bus | 4:15 PM |
| Daily Bus Routes | 3 Ø |
| Distance | 23.4 miles |
| Bus Companies | Rede Expressos |
Cheapest bus connections from Viana do Castelo to Braga
Every day, 3 buses from 1 bus companies leave Viana do Castelo for Braga: in the table below, you will find the cheapest prices for a bus ticket for this route, starting from 12/17/2025 and for the following days.
The cheapest time to travel from Viana do Castelo to Braga
How to save money travelling from Viana do Castelo to Braga
Book the ticket from Viana do Castelo to Braga in advance! The earlier you book, the cheaper usually the price is. Also, you will be sure to have a place on the bus from Viana do Castelo to Braga, compared instead if you buy it at the last moment, or directly at the station.
If you can, avoid travelling at peak times. Instead of weekend, try travelling during the week. Travelling in the evening or at night it’s also cheaper, and later buses from Viana do Castelo to Braga are also emptier.All bus stations and stops in Viana do Castelo and Braga
In the map below, you can see where to find all bus stations in Viana do Castelo and Braga.
Compare the bus with other modes of transport
Service and Comfort on the bus from Viana do Castelo to Braga
FAQs about the Viana do Castelo to Braga bus
How much does a Viana do Castelo Braga bus trip cost?
How much could I save by comparing buses from Viana do Castelo to Braga?
On average, how many connections are available from Viana do Castelo to Braga each day?
How long does a bus journey from Viana do Castelo to Braga take?
What time is the first bus from Viana do Castelo to Braga?
What time is the last bus from Viana do Castelo to Braga?
Which bus companies operate the Viana do Castelo Braga route?
Is there a direct bus between Viana do Castelo and Braga?
What can I take with me on the Viana do Castelo to Braga bus route?
What equipment is available for the Viana do Castelo Braga bus route?
How does CheckMyBus find the best bus deals from Viana do Castelo to Braga?
How does CheckMyBus technology work for trips from Viana do Castelo to Braga?
Available seat classes which are offered on the bus route Viana do Castelo to Braga
Name referring to the typical seat you will find with companies that don’t distinguish between different classes.
The cheapest option available for your ticket, it usually comes with reclinable seats and AC.
More bus routes to Viana do Castelo and to Braga
- Bus Routes to Viana do Castelo
- Bus Aveiro - Viana do Castelo
- Caminha to Viana do Castelo bus
- Bus from Ermesinde to Viana do Castelo
- Bus from Esposende to Viana do Castelo
- Buses to Viana do Castelo from Fátima
- Bus from Leiria to Viana do Castelo
- Lisbon to Viana do Castelo bus
- Bus Penafiel - Viana do Castelo
- Buses Ponte de Lima to Viana do Castelo
- Buses Porto to Viana do Castelo
- Bus to Viana do Castelo from Setúbal
- Bus Valença do Minho - Viana do Castelo
- Buses Vigo - Viana do Castelo
- Vila Nova de Cerveira to Viana do Castelo bus
- Bus Viseu - Viana do Castelo
- Bus Routes to Braga
- Bus to Braga from A Coruña
- From Albufeira to Braga bus
- Buses from Armação de Pêra to Braga
- Bus from Braganza to Braga
- Buses to Braga from Castelo Branco
- Buses to Braga from Chaves
- Bus from Covilhã to Braga
- Bus from Fafe to Braga
- Bus to Braga from Fátima
- From Guarda to Braga bus
- Buses Paris - Braga
- Buses Póvoa de Varzim to Braga
- Buses Santa Maria da Feira - Braga
- Buses to Braga from Sintra
- Buses from Tábua to Braga
- Toulouse to Braga bus
- Buses from Valença do Minho to Braga
- Bus Vila Nova de Famalicão - Braga
- Bus from Vila Real to Braga
- Buses to Braga from Vitoria-Gasteiz

